Why Converting From A Cassette Tape To A USB Is Necessary

I’ve realized that converting my old cassette tapes to USB is absolutely necessary for several reasons. First, cassette tapes are fragile and degrade over time. My favorite recordings have started to sound fuzzy and distorted, and I’m worried they’ll eventually become completely unplayable. By transferring them to USB, I can preserve the original audio quality and keep those memories safe for years to come.

Another reason is convenience. Carrying around a bulky cassette player and tapes is cumbersome, but with a USB drive, all my audio files are stored digitally in one small device. I can easily listen to my recordings on my computer, phone, or car stereo without needing special equipment. This has made enjoying my old music and voice recordings so much easier and more accessible.

Lastly, converting to USB allows me to organize and share my collection effortlessly. I can label files, create playlists, and even share my cherished recordings with family and friends through email or cloud services. In contrast, sharing cassette tapes requires physically handing them over, which isn’t always practical. Overall, digitizing my cassette tapes has been a game-changer for preserving and enjoying my audio memories.

My Buying Guides on Converting From A Cassette Tape To A Usb

When I decided to convert my old cassette tapes to USB, I quickly realized that having the right equipment makes all the difference. Here’s what I learned through my experience to help you choose the best tools for this task.

1. Understanding What You Need

Before buying anything, I took stock of what I already had and what I needed. To convert cassette tapes to USB, you need a way to play the tapes and a way to capture the audio digitally. Typically, this involves:

  • A cassette player (preferably with a headphone or line-out jack)
  • An audio interface or USB cassette converter
  • Software to record and save audio files

2. Choosing a Cassette Player

If you don’t already have a cassette player, or yours is old and unreliable, investing in a good-quality player is important. I looked for players that had a line-out jack because this gives a cleaner signal than recording through speakers and a microphone. Some key features I considered:

  • USB cassette players that connect directly to your computer
  • Standard cassette decks with line-out or headphone jack
  • Portability and ease of use

3. USB Cassette Converters vs. Audio Interfaces

There are two main ways to get audio from your cassette player into your computer:

  • USB Cassette Converters: These are all-in-one devices that have a built-in cassette player and USB output. They’re very convenient but sometimes limited in audio quality.
  • Audio Interfaces / Sound Cards: If you already have a cassette player, you can connect it to your computer’s line-in or through an external USB audio interface for potentially better quality.

I personally preferred a USB cassette converter for its simplicity, but if you want better control over audio quality, an audio interface is the way to go.

4. Audio Recording Software

Once your hardware is set up, you need software to record the audio. I used free programs like Audacity, which is user-friendly and powerful. When choosing software, look for:

  • Compatibility with your computer’s operating system
  • Ability to record in WAV or MP3 format
  • Editing tools to clean up noise or split tracks

5. Features to Look For When Buying

From my experience, here are some features that made the conversion process smoother:

  • Plug-and-play USB connection: No complicated drivers or setups
  • Noise reduction features: To improve audio quality
  • Batch recording or auto-splitting: To separate songs automatically
  • Portability: If you want to convert tapes on the go

6. Budget Considerations

Prices vary a lot. Basic USB cassette converters can be very affordable, while high-end audio interfaces and professional cassette decks cost more. I set a budget and balanced quality with ease of use. If you only have a few tapes, a basic converter might be enough. For large collections, investing in better equipment pays off.
